1. Quality of Materials and Durability

The foundation of any good packaging solution lies in the quality of materials used. A reputable packaging supplier should offer durable, high-quality materials that protect your products during transit and storage. Whether you require corrugated cardboard, rigid boxes, or eco-friendly options, the supplier must provide materials that withstand handling, shipping, and environmental factors. Poor-quality packaging can lead to damaged goods, increased return rates, and a negative customer experience. Before committing to a supplier, request samples to assess the sturdiness, print quality, and overall finish of their packaging.

3. Minimum Order Quantities (MOQs) and Wholesale Options

For startups and small businesses, high minimum order quantities (MOQs) can be a barrier. However, many packaging suppliers wholesale offer flexible MOQs, allowing businesses to order smaller batches without compromising quality or affordability. If you’re testing a new product or operating on a tight budget, seek suppliers that provide low MOQs or scalable solutions. Conversely, if you require bulk orders, ensure the supplier can handle large-scale production without delays.

5. Cost-Effectiveness and Pricing Transparency

While cost shouldn’t be the sole deciding factor, it’s essential to work with a packaging supplier that offers competitive pricing without sacrificing quality. Request detailed quotes from multiple suppliers and compare them based on material quality, customization options, and additional services. Beware of hidden fees—reputable suppliers provide transparent pricing structures, including costs for design, printing, and shipping. If you’re looking for packaging suppliers wholesale, bulk discounts can significantly reduce per-unit costs, improving your profit margins.

6. Eco-Friendly Packaging Solutions

Sustainability is no longer optional—consumers and businesses alike prioritize environmentally friendly packaging. A forward-thinking packaging supplier should offer eco-conscious materials such as recycled paper, biodegradable plastics, or plant-based inks. If your brand emphasizes sustainability, verify that the supplier follows ethical sourcing practices and holds relevant certifications (e.g., FSC, ISO 14001). Choosing green packaging not only benefits the environment but also enhances your brand’s reputation among eco-aware customers.
